In a hat shop, a difficult lady customer, with her dog is looking for the perfect hat. The salesman does his best but the lady's jealous dog has other things in mind.
2014
2017
2018
2007
2020
1941
2016
2009
2004
2019
1992
1994
1998
1973
2008
2013